About Oil Thermostat

OEMatch Oil Thermostat — Fit, Function, Confidence

The oil thermostat controls oil flow to the cooler based on temperature, helping the engine reach operating temperature quickly and maintaining stable oil temperatures under load. The oil thermostat itself is a temperature-sensitive valve that diverts oil through the cooler when required; its operation helps reduce cold-start wear and prevents overheating during sustained high-load running. Typical construction uses heat-resistant alloys and durable seals chosen to tolerate long-term exposure to hot oil.

Why Oil Thermostat Wear and Fail
  • Thermal fatigue from repeated heating and cooling cycles
  • Oil contamination or sludge causing sticking or sluggish response
  • Degraded seals or cracked housings leading to leaks and poor thermal response
